  • Title

    Eigensystem spectrum estimation methods applied to absorption interferometric spectroscopy

  • Abstract
    The authors discuss the relative performance of two high-resolution eigensystem methods, applied to spectrum estimation problems as encountered in Fourier transform spectroscopy. The goal is to estimate the value of the parameters required to specify the nonlinear model of the transmittance spectrum as described by D.J. Gingras and J.F. Bohme (1986). The authors begin with the MUSIC model. They present a modified version of MUSIC based on an extended model that takes the line broadening into account. Experimental results on the resolving capability of the extended method for different length of the covariance function and SNR is given.
